In this paper, we propose a new proactive password checker, a program which prevents the choice of easy-to-guess passwords. The checker uses a decision tree, constructed applying the minimum description length principle and a pessimistic pruning technique. Experimental results show a substantial improvement in performance of this checker compared to previous proposals. Moreover, the whole software package we provide has a user-friendly interface, enabling the system administrator to configure an ad hoc password proactive checker, in order to satisfy certain policy requirements.
